    Originally the Hull Theater in Uptown, this elevator building was developed into 2, 3 & 4 bedroom modern apartments. Maintaining the historic facade, including the metal gorilla, this fully concrete building is structurally sound and helps prevent noise within the building, creating a peaceful living situation on this residential street. The building is walking distance to lots of shopping, restaurants and the Wilson L Stop (Red & Purple Line).     Anchored by Uptown and Andersonville, 60640 blends historic architecture and a rich immigrant and jazz legacy with breezy lakefront living. Expect four true seasons with cooler summers by the water, easy access to Foster Beach, the Lakefront Trail, Margate Park, and the beloved Puptown Dog Park. Culture runs deep at the Green Mill, Riviera Theatre, and Aragon Ballroom, while the Argyle corridor serves up standout Vietnamese and pan-Asian eats, and Andersonville’s Clark Street mixes indie shops with Swedish roots. Day to day is comfortably walkable: groceries at H Mart, Mariano’s, and Jewel-Osco; coffee and pastries at Lost Larson and Dollop; destination dining at Hopleaf and neighborhood favorites along Clark, Broadway, and Argyle. The area is known for a friendly, community-forward vibe and is both family- and pet-friendly. Transit is a breeze with CTA Red Line stops (Argyle, Lawrence, Wilson) and the nearby Ravenswood Metra UP-N.
